Latest Patents
Tatyana holds a patent for "Silicon-based cannabidiol derivatives and compositions thereof." This patent describes silicon-based cannabidiol derivatives that contain a cannabidiol molecule and at least one silicon-based group featuring Si—O—Si bonds. These derivatives are designed to enhance solubility and compatibility in cosmetic formulations, making them useful in various cosmetic and topical compositions.
